A member asked:

I've had right sided pain on and off for 6 years doctors have said ibs but i've never had a colonoscopy, doctor said if cancer i would know by now?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Diagnose w/exclusion: Irritable bowel syndrome (ibs) is a condition associated w/ abdominal discomfort, altered stool pattern, & among others accompanying nausea, bloating, gassiness. Often improved by stooling, ibs is defined by changes in perception of gut distension, motility, sensation. Diet & emotional stress play significant roles here in such patients. Need to rule out first inflammation, ischemia, & infection.
